Possible causes of water damage to tile and grout

Water damage in tile and grout surfaces often stems from plumbing leaks, burst pipes, or fixtures that have become faulty over time. In Natural Steps, Arkansas, aging plumbing systems and heavy usage can increase the risk of leaks that seep into the tile’s substrate, causing damage beneath the surface. This hidden moisture can weaken the grout lines, leading to issues such as cracking, discoloration, or even mold growth if not addressed promptly.

Another common cause is water intrusion from flooding or heavy rainfall, which can seep through improperly sealed tiles or damaged grout. Over time, water trapped beneath tile surfaces can cause the adhesive to loosen, resulting in tiles shifting or detaching. Poor installation practices or structural issues in the foundation can also contribute to water infiltration, amplifying the risk of extensive water damage that affects both the appearance and structural integrity of your tiled surfaces.

How can we fix that

Our team begins by conducting a comprehensive assessment of your tile and grout area to identify the source and extent of the water damage. We use specialized moisture meters and inspection techniques to detect hidden water beneath the surface. Once we diagnose the issue, we develop a tailored restoration plan to effectively eliminate all traces of moisture and prevent future damage.

We then carefully remove damaged grout and tiles if necessary, ensuring that we do not cause further harm to the surrounding surfaces. Our experts utilize high-quality cleaning and drying equipment to thoroughly dry out the area, including sub-surface drying systems that target moisture trapped beneath tiles. After the area is completely dry, we meticulously restore the grout lines using durable, water-resistant materials to enhance longevity and appearance.

Finally, we apply protective sealants to your tile and grout surfaces. This barrier helps prevent future water infiltration and makes routine maintenance easier. Does water damage to tile and grout cause mold?

Yes, prolonged moisture beneath tiles creates an ideal environment for mold growth. That’s why prompt drying and moisture removal are crucial. Our professionals specialize in thorough mold prevention and removal during restoration to keep your home safe and healthy.
